2. High-Intent Introduction

Core Concept: In auto finance, yield structure negotiation refers to the deliberate process of structuring the spread (margin) between lender rates and end-customer rates, directly impacting dealer profitability. The “Why” (Value Proposition): Mastery of competitive yield negotiation is essential for dealers seeking to maximize finance income, protect against margin erosion, and maintain a strategic advantage in a market where lender terms and incentives rapidly shift.

4. Evidence-Based Clarification

4.1. Worked Example

Scenario: A Singapore-based dealer receives offers from three financiers. Financier A proposes a 1.88% base rate with a 0.60% dealer margin, Financier B offers 2.18% with a 0.80% margin, and Financier C offers a tiered incentive: 0.55% for the first 10 deals, 0.75% for the next 20. Action/Result: By utilizing structured negotiation (guided by platform checklists), the dealer secures an average margin of 0.75%, up from the market standard of 0.60%, resulting in an immediate increase of S$150 per financed unit.
